Identity and Autonomy: Redefining Leadership Beyond Mentorship

Romana’s arc is the narrative’s thematic center: she evolves from a companion guided by the Doctor to a leader who defines her own purpose, asserting independence by choosing to guide the Tharils into freedom. This redefinition of identity is paralleled by the Doctor’s painful concession of Kira’s sacrifice and his silent trust in Romana’s leadership. bireoc’s role as a guide—neither a ruler nor a slave—symbolizes how autonomy is reclaimed through wisdom and timing. The mirror dimension itself becomes a metaphor for transformation, where roles invert and leadership is measured by service. This challenges the franchise’s legacy of paternalistic mentorship and proposes that genuine leadership lies in empowerment, not control. The theme is crystallized when Romana steps into the mirror not as a follower, but as a liberator.
